Output 17db1dbf6276e46f7e84f87a8dbd8362ce66ee5825a63cd8c4fedfc2920628f8:0

value
21991064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a3ef75265f5d1d045f278f2e78c8b8d00a5073 OP_EQUAL
address
34ktcJbNr7Tr6QGozHL8yDrvweJBXwrbrv
transaction
17db1dbf6276e46f7e84f87a8dbd8362ce66ee5825a63cd8c4fedfc2920628f8
spent
true